- Phone and smartwatch policy
- Must be turned off and put away in backpack or locked in teacher drawer
- May not be used anytime while at school.
- Student may come to main office to use phone if there is an emergency
- Visitor’s Policy
- Enter through front of school, sign in at main office and obtain a visitor’s pass
- Volunteers must also sign in and wear volunteer badge at all times while on campus. Please return badge before leaving.
- Toys and personal belongings
- Toys, candy and personal items should not come to school. School is not responsible for lost or stolen personal belongings.
